Mother See hosts international conference of Armenian libraries

The solemn opening of the fourth international conference of Armenian libraries was held at Vatche and Tamar Manoukian Manuscript Depository (Matenadaran) at the Mother See of Hoply Etchmiadzin today.

The conference titled “Preserving the past for the sake of future” is dedicated to the 350th anniversary of publishing of the first Armenian Bible.

The event has been organized by the Mother See of Holy Etchmiadzin, the Armenian Ministry of Culture and the National Library.

The opening ceremony was attended by His Holiness Karenin II, Supreme Patriarch and Catholicos of All Armenians, and Minister of Culture Armen Amiryan.

“The anniversary of  publishing of the Armenian Holy Book is a remarkable opportunity for the Armenian people to once again value their written legacy and the tireless efforts and dedication our devotees have demonstrated to create this heritage. Printing is one of the greatest achievements of mankind, which made it possible for the achievements of human brain to disseminate and reach all layers of society. Printing became one of the favorable conditions shaping the modern civilization,” His Holiness Karekin II said in his opening remarks.

Minister of Culture Armen Amiryan voiced hope that the conference would serve its goals – to support the centers of Armenology, to help libraries register the Armenian printed heritage, to contribute to the long-term maintenance and popularization of the Armenian legacy.

“I hope new routes of cooperation will be found as a result of discussions, new models of digitization and preservation will be offered,” Armen Amiryan said.

CSTO Collective Security Council holds sitting in restricted format

Today, at the Presidential Palace started a session of the CSTO Collective Security Council in the restricted format with the participation of the President of the Russian Federation Vladimir Putin, President of the Republic of Belarus Alexander Lukashenko, President of the Republic of Kyrgyzstan Almazbek Atambaev, President of the Republic of Tajikistan Emomali Rahmon, Prime Minister of Kazakhstan Bakijan Sagintaev, and Secretary General of the CSTO Nikolay Bordzyuzha. The session is chaired by the President of Armenia which was presiding in the Council between the sessions of 2015-2016.

Welcoming the participants of the session and noting that today Armenia’s presidency at the CSTO comes to an end, President Sargsyan underscored that Armenia attaches great importance to the success of the Yerevan summit.

“We have tried to do our best so that our mutual work is sapid and efficient, for the benefit of the cooperation of our countries in the Organization and for the development of the CSTO in general. It is expected that today we will discuss a wide range of issues related to the earlier adopted decisions. Discussed will be a number of documents, adoption of which will set the guidelines of our cooperation in the nearest future.

I am confident that traditions of a constructive mood and mutual assistance will be with us during this session too, which will allow to operatively endorse and adopt important decisions.

Once again, as the accepting side, I welcome you to Armenia. Welcome to Yerevan,” said the President of Armenia during his welcoming remarks addressed to the participants of the session of the CSTO Collective Security Council.

The session in the restricted format will be followed by the session in the extended format with the participation of the official delegations of the CSTO member states.

Man Utd asks for Mkhitaryan’s withdrawal from Armenia’s upcoming two matches

Armenia captain Henrikh Mkhitaryan will probably miss the upcoming matches against Romania and Poland, Press Service of the Football Federation of Armenia (FFA) informs.
The FFA has received an official letter from Manchester United, requesting a permission of Henrikh Mkhitaryan’s withdrawal from upcoming training camp and official matches. The head of Manchester United FC Medicine and Science medical, Dr. Steve McNally wrote:

“Henrikh is still undergoing late stage rehabilitation from the left thigh muscle injury that he sustained earlier this month whilst playing for Manchester United. Although his progress has been good over the past week, he is participating in limited aspects of team training and is not yet able to train fully without restrictions or play competitively. In view of that I would be grateful if he could be allowed to withdraw from the National Team for the forthcoming training camp and FIFA World Cup Qualifying matches in order to remain in Manchester to complete his rehabilitation.”

Son of candidate to Gyumri Mayor’s Office dead, election campaign haled

All major political forces have halted the election campaign after the death of the son of a candidate running for Gyumri Mayor’s Office.

Arshak Grigoryna, the son of Vardevan Grigorian from Prosperous Armenia Party, was admitted to Gyumri Medical Center with a gunshot wound in the head at about 13:20 today.

The investigation has revealed that the young man was wounded as a result of gunshot in the basement of their house.

Criminal case has been launched under Articles 110.1 (Causing somebody to commit suicide or make an attempt at a suicide by indirect willfulness or by negligence, by means of threat, cruel treatment or regular humiliation of one’s dignity) and 235.1 (Illegal procurement, transportation, keeping or carrying of weapons, explosives or explosive devices, except smoothbore long-barrel hunting guns, ammunition) of the Criminal Code.

Armenia’s Vice-Speaker to monitor Russian parliamentary elections

Vice-President of the National Assembly, Head of the Armenian delegation to the CSTO Parliamentary Assembly Edward Sharmazanov will pay a working visit to Saint Petersburg September 16-20.

Sharmazanov will monitor the Russian parliamentary elections within the monitoring mission of the CSTO Parliamentary Assembly.

The Vice-Speaker is expected to meet with CSTO Executive Secretary Pyotr Ryabukhin and leadership of the Lennigrad Region.

Memorial dedicated to Artsakh War heroes unveiled in Getavan village

On 7 September Artsakh Republic President Bako Sahakyan visited the Getavan village of the Martakert region and partook at a solemn opening ceremony of memorial complex devoted to the memory of freedom fighters from Getavan perished during the Artsakh Liberation struggle.

The Head of the State highlighted the significance of such initiatives from the viewpoints of keeping the nation’s devotees memory bright and patriotic upbringing of the younger generation.

On the same day Bako Sahakyan was present at a “Hrashapar” service held at the Gandzasar monastery with the participation of His Holiness Karekin II, Supreme Patriarch and Catholicos fo All Armenians.

National Assembly chairman Ashot Ghoulyan and other officials partook at the events.
